Environment + Sustainability
31% GHG Reduction
Operational Emissions Reduced
The company has reduced its operational greenhouse gas emissions by 31% since 2018, amounting to 302,845 metric tons of CO2 equivalents.
Carbon Neutral by 2030
Commitment to Carbon Neutrality
The company aims to achieve carbon-neutral operations by 2030, focusing on reducing carbon emissions across all operational activities.
58M Metric Tons (Scope 3)
Scope 3 Emissions in 2023
In 2023, the company reported Scope 3 greenhouse gas emissions of 58,449,862 metric tons of CO2 equivalents, reflecting emissions from the entire value chain.
$3B Invested
Sustainable R&D Funding
The company has committed over $3 billion to research and development for sustainable solutions, highlighting its investment in eco-friendly innovations.
Aiming to reduce Scope 1 and Scope 2 GHG emissions by 50% by 2030 compared to 2018 levels.
Targeting a 15% reduction in Scope 3 emissions by 2030 from 2018 levels.
Achieving zero-waste-to-landfill certification for 79% of manufacturing sites, up from 75% in 2022, with a 2030 target of 100%.
Certifying 16% of manufacturing sites as zero-water-discharge, surpassing the 2030 target of 10% for water-stressed sites.
Independent verification of Scope 1 and Scope 2 GHG data with reasonable assurance and Scope 3 data with limited assurance.
Deploying clean-energy projects such as solar microgrids, PV installations, and carports, reducing over 20,000 metric tons of CO2 equivalents annually.
